地图生成后是HTML文件。有了省级地图之后,如果我们想链接到市级地图。我们可以自己改一下生成的地图的HTML源代码。

打开要增加链接的地图文件,例如"全国.html",直接到代码的最后部分,找到这个代码:

然后在这句代码的后面增加增加下面这段代码(一定不要放在最前面,否则会什么都显示不出来,即添加在“

chart_9f7daf28f6ea4ac6bc2391ce2953d14c.setOption(option_9f7daf28f6ea4ac6bc2391ce2953d14c);

”和“</script>”之间):

<!--注意要把下面这段代码中的chart_后面的一串数字改成自己生成的地图id--> chart_9f7daf28f6ea4ac6bc2391ce2953d14c.on('click', function (param){var selected = param.name;if (selected) {switch(selected){case '北京':location.href = "./北京地图.html";break;case '上海':location.href = "./上海地图.html";break;#作为示例代码,这里省去了很多内容case '重庆':location.href = "./重庆地图.html";break;default:break;}}});

当然,如果我们有很多地图的时候,要把这些case的地名列出来,可以编程去生成:

# -*- coding:utf-8 -*-list1 =[
'安庆市',
'蚌埠市',
'亳州市',
'池州市',
'滁州市',
'阜阳市',
'合肥市',
'淮北市',
'淮南市',
'黄山市',
'六安市',
'马鞍山市',
'铜陵市',
'芜湖市',
'宿州市',
'宣城市',
'佛山市',
'广州市',
'河源市',
'惠州市',
'江门市',
'揭阳市',
'茂名市',
'梅州市',
'清远市',
'汕头市',
'汕尾市',
'韶关市',
'深圳市',
'阳江市',
'云浮市',
'湛江市',
'肇庆市',
'珠海市',
'中山市',
'东莞市',
]list2 =[
'安徽省安庆市',
'安徽省蚌埠市',
'安徽省亳州市',
'安徽省池州市',
'安徽省滁州市',
'安徽省阜阳市',
'安徽省合肥市',
'安徽省淮北市',
'安徽省淮南市',
'安徽省黄山市',
'安徽省六安市',
'安徽省马鞍山市',
'安徽省铜陵市',
'安徽省芜湖市',
'安徽省宿州市',
'安徽省宣城市',
'广东省潮州市',
'广东省佛山市',
'广东省广州市',
'广东省河源市',
'广东省惠州市',
'广东省江门市',
'广东省揭阳市',
'广东省茂名市',
'广东省梅州市',
'广东省清远市',
'广东省汕头市',
'广东省汕尾市',
'广东省韶关市',
'广东省深圳市',
'广东省阳江市',
'广东省云浮市',
'广东省湛江市',
'广东省肇庆市',
'广东省珠海市',
'广东省中山市',
'广东省东莞市',
]for i in range(len(list1)):print("case '"+list1[i]+"':")print("    location.href=\"./市级地图/"+list2[i]+"地图.html\";")print("    break;")

运行结果:

使用Pyecharts进行全国水质TDS地图可视化全过程10:地图的下钻,实现省、市、区县的联动相关推荐

  1. 使用Pyecharts进行全国水质TDS地图可视化全过程1:总体过程简述

    目录 一.效果图 二.实现过程1:数据来源及清洗 三.实现过程2:数据分析 四.实现过程3:数据可视化 分享使用Pyecharts进行全国水质TDS地图可视化的全过程. 一.效果图 本次对全国TDS进 ...

  2. 使用Pyecharts进行全国水质TDS地图可视化全过程6:利用Python+Selenium自动化获取页面信息

    本文是扩展文,介绍利用Selenium模拟人工操作,从网页上自动获取信息.这样一种方法可以处理重复性工作,解放双手,提高工作效率.属于使用Pyecharts做可视化之前的一些其他探索. 在利用Exce ...

  3. 使用Pyecharts进行全国水质TDS地图可视化全过程7:使用pyecharts画地图总述

    目录 一.什么是pyecharts? 二.安装pyecharts? 三.pyecharts使用文档 四.pyecharts画地图 五.需要注意的事项 六.地图的下钻 本文为总述.后面几篇文章再详细的拿 ...

  4. 使用Pyecharts进行全国水质TDS地图可视化全过程5:利用Excel地图实现美国水质地图可视化

    本文是扩展文,介绍使用Excel进行地图可视化.属于使用Pyecharts做可视化之前的一些其他探索. 今天我们讲下如何利用Excel自带的Power Map做可视化,2013版EXCEL开始,自带了 ...

  5. 使用Pyecharts进行全国水质TDS地图可视化全过程3:用Python拆分物流地址以及实现地址补全

    目录 1.提取省市区信息 2.提取街镇乡.村或居委会信息 3.自动补全省市信息 简介:本文介绍用Python编程,实现对物流地址的拆分及补全.在快递物流中会用到这种技术. 在TDS地图可视化项目中,我 ...

  6. 使用Pyecharts进行全国水质TDS地图可视化全过程4:使用Python将Excel表拆分至多个Excel文件

    在TDS可视化项目中,我们需要对省.市.区各个层级区域的TDS数据进行计算.它涉及的数量很大,大概有3211个区域的数据. 我们当然可以编程直接在一个表格上处理,但是涉及到这么多区域,它会很容易出错, ...

  7. 使用Pyecharts进行全国水质TDS地图可视化全过程2:使用Power Query 进行百万行级别数据匹配

    简介:本文介绍使用Excel  Power Query进行数据匹配.利用这种方式,可以在几分钟内完成百万级别数据量的匹配. 在TDS可视化地图项目中,我们的原始数据没有TDS和具体安装地址的对应,我们 ...

  8. R语言ggplot2进行特定国家或者地区的地图可视化、在地图上标出所有首府城市所在地(plot the locations of the capital cities)

    R语言ggplot2进行特定国家或者地区的地图可视化.在地图上标出所有首府城市所在地(plot the locations of the  capital cities) 目录

  9. [Pyhon大数据分析] 二.PyEcharts绘制全国各地区、某省各城市地图及可视化分析

    思来想去,虽然很忙,但还是挤时间针对这次YQ写个Python大数据分析系列博客,包括网络爬虫.可视化分析.GIS地图显示.情感分析.舆情分析.主题挖掘.威胁情报溯源.知识图谱.预测预警及AI和NLP应 ...

最新文章

  1. kali入侵windows
  2. tideways+xhgui搭建php 7的性能测试环境
  3. win7+ubuntu20.04双系统+easybcd安装以及Reached target Reboot卡住问题
  4. 基于 Consul 实现 MagicOnion(GRpc) 服务注册与发现
  5. python爬取小说出现乱码_详解Python解决抓取内容乱码问题(decode和encode解码)
  6. 阿里开发者们的第5个感悟:听话,出活 1
  7. 提交文件至服务器的设置——表单属性中的 enctype
  8. mysql树状查询优化_解析SQL中树形分层数据的查询优化
  9. arcgis属性表选择两个条件_ARCGIS关联属性表(转)
  10. FFmpeg总结(一)FFmpeg官方文档分块
  11. 海底捞、百果园、大娘水饺凭什么可以疯狂扩张门店?
  12. SVProgressHUD的使用
  13. for循环:100以内奇数之和
  14. BasicVSR++: Improving Video Super-Resolution with Enhanced Propagation and Alignment阅读笔记
  15. Spark未授权访问getshell
  16. python爬虫 | 爬取巨潮资讯上的上市公司招股说明书
  17. 商洛师范学院计算机老师,我校在首届全国师范生微课大赛中获佳绩
  18. Codeforces 821B Okabe and Banana Trees 题解
  19. word无法显示图像计算机可能没有足够的,Word图片显示不出来怎么办 Word图片显空白的解决办法-电脑教程...
  20. Axure8.0 -手机端长文字滚动演示

热门文章

  1. 多元线性回归学习疑点记录
  2. C语言最简单的变量交换,【C语言】5种妙招教你轻松搞定变量值交换
  3. Java多线程系列之“JUC集合“详解
  4. 文字特效-第12届蓝桥杯Scratch国赛真题第1题
  5. PHP 7面向对象的全部文章(OOP)
  6. R语言小代码7(流程控制练习)
  7. mysql_dc.ncf_GitHub - ytyagi1025/PythonPractice: Python practice works
  8. python电商数据预处理
  9. Synopsys Design Compiler使用分享
  10. 全志A33Linux连接脚本,全志A33编译脚本分析